Explain why blood oozes from a venous wound rather than spurting as it does from an arterial wound
irina1246 [14]

The venous system is low pressure using either gravity from the upper body or muscle action from the lower body (when we sit/stand). It does have a little pressure naturally. So a cut oozes blood unless you hit an artery. That is high pressure blood carrying oxygen to tissues.
